LLM?  Vision System? Not Good Enough....

LLM? Vision System? Not Good Enough....

Terminology is extremely important in any communication. It is the definition and context that is applied to the arrangement of symbols used. As I've worked on JARVITS, the Terms: LLM, Vision System, Research Model and others have fallen short in accurately describing What JARVITS IS and Can Do.

One of the greatest uses for current AI is Terminological Context. It's how they're made. Understanding this, I asked Gemini AI, if my nagging "Feeling" about using these terms while working on JARVITS had more concrete and Logical Basis.

It does. We should use some New Terminology when discussing JARVITS from here on out. If you're interested, please read below and comment to have a Vote. You will help Guide our JARVITS development. You will help make sure that we focus on making the JARVITS system a truly Ethical and Human First AI. Thank you, I appreciate your time and help in making sure this works for Us All......

The Prompt to Gemini AI:

As I was getting things together for getting the server we discussed earlier, something stood out to me. You used the Example of Training JARVITS as say an "LLM" or "vision system". Given the adaptability, interconnectedness of various modules and the hierarchical nature of the architecture overall, should we look to refine those types of Terms for better context? Reference that inspired question: Specific Examples (Illustrative):

Large Language Models (LLMs):

Fine-tuning a large pre-trained model like BERT or a CodeBERT variant on your laptop with a GTX 1050 would be extremely slow, if not impossible due to VRAM limitations. You'd be limited to very small batch sizes and very short sequence lengths. On the workstation, you could fine-tune much larger models with larger batch sizes and longer sequence lengths, leading to significantly better results. Training a large LLM from scratch is only feasible on high-end hardware like the workstation.

Computer Vision:

Training a deep convolutional neural network for image classification or object detection on a large dataset (like ImageNet) would be impractical on your laptop. On the workstation, it would be much faster and allow you to explore more complex architectures.

Gemini's Response:

You've identified a very important point! The terms "LLM" and "vision system," while commonly used, are indeed too narrow and limiting to accurately describe the full scope and potential of JARVITS, especially given its unique architecture and design principles. You're right to seek more appropriate terminology.

Here's a breakdown of why the traditional terms fall short, and some suggestions for better alternatives, along with explanations:

Why "LLM" and "Vision System" are Insufficient:

  • Oversimplification: JARVITS, as envisioned, is much more than just a language model or a vision system. It's intended to be a general-purpose, adaptable AI assistant capable of handling a wide range of tasks and integrating multiple modalities (text, code, images, potentially audio, and more).
  • Limited Scope: "LLM" specifically refers to models trained on text data. While NLP is a crucial component of JARVITS, it's not the only component. Similarly, "vision system" only refers to image/video processing.
  • Static vs. Dynamic: Traditional LLMs and vision systems are typically trained on a fixed dataset and then deployed. JARVITS, with its MICT framework, is designed for continuous learning and adaptation. This dynamic aspect is not captured by the standard terms.
  • Component vs. System: "LLM" and "vision system" often refer to individual models or components. JARVITS is a complete system that integrates multiple models, data sources, and reasoning mechanisms.
  • Hierarchical: LLM and Vision models are specific, lower, levels of understanding.

Better Terminology (Alternatives):

Here are some alternative terms and phrases you could use to describe JARVITS and its components, along with explanations of why they are more appropriate:

  1. Instead of "LLM":
  2. Instead of "Vision System":
  3. For JARVITS as a Whole:

Recommendations:

  • For Internal Use: Within your team and your technical documentation, use terms like "Language Understanding Module (LUM)" and "Visual Perception Module (VPM)" to refer to the specific components. This promotes clarity and avoids confusion.
  • For External Communication (Website, Presentations, etc.):
  • For The Overall System: Integrated Cognitive System (ICS) or a similar derivative.

Example Usage (in a sentence):

  • Instead of: "JARVITS uses an LLM to understand user requests."
  • Better: "JARVITS, an adaptive cognitive system based on the MICT framework, utilizes a Language Understanding Module (LUM) to process and interpret user requests."
  • Instead of: "The vision system allows JARVITS to identify objects in images."
  • Better: "The Visual Perception Module (VPM) within JARVITS enables it to analyze images and identify objects, contributing to its overall understanding of the environment."
  • Instead of "We are using an LLM and a vision system"
  • Better "We are using an Integrated Cognitive System, an ICS."

Conclusion:

By using more precise and descriptive terminology, you can better communicate the unique capabilities of JARVITS and avoid being lumped in with existing, more limited AI systems. This is crucial for attracting investors, collaborators, and users who understand the transformative potential of your work. It also helps to position JARVITS correctly within the broader AI landscape.


#AI #ArtificialIntelligence #DeepLearning #QuantumComputing #CognitiveScience #SystemsThinking #Theory #Research #Innovation #MICT #MobiusTheory #JARVITS #EthicalAI

要查看或添加评论,请登录

John Reagan的更多文章

社区洞察

其他会员也浏览了